Vintage McKinney • Spacious '70s Ranch, Hot Tub • 8 min to Downtown
Cozy vintage-inspired retreat 8 minutes from Historic Downtown McKinney. This thoughtfully restored 1970s ranch is filled with antique details and retro charm — every room has been curated to feel warm, lived-in, and a little bit out of time. Whether you're traveling for work, an extended stay, or an antique-hunting weekend on McKinney's historic square, this house is built for comfort.
SLEEPING ARRANGEMENTS — Sleeps up to 9 across four bedrooms: • Bedroom 1 — King bed (primary, with TV and Chromecast) • Bedroom 2 — Queen bed. A pack 'n play and changing pad are in this closet, help yourself, no need to ask. • Bedroom 3 — Queen bed, plus a foldaway queen frame and mattress stored in the closet • Bedroom 4 — Twin bed in a converted sunroom: fully insulated, air-conditioned, French doors with curtains for privacy, a desk, and a separate back-door entrance. Perfect for a remote-working partner or a teen who wants their own space.
OUTDOOR Hot tub out back, with an outdoor sectional and dining set on the concrete patio and a tree swing in the yard. Fully fenced with mature shade and raised garden beds. There's a double gate off the driveway and a long concrete pad — if you're traveling with a trailer or something over 20 feet, message me ahead and we'll make room for it.
THE STREET The lot is quiet and well spaced, with no townhome density on either side. The street stays calm and the immediate neighbors keep the same hours we do. Quiet hours are 10 PM to 8 AM.
Planning a get-together? Message me first with what you have in mind and roughly how many people, and we'll work out a fee that makes sense. What I can't do is a surprise.
KITCHEN Fully equipped: full-size refrigerator, electric stove and oven, dishwasher, microwave, toaster, waffle maker, drip and Keurig coffee makers. Pots and pans, knife set, cutting boards, baking sheets, muffin pan, mixing bowls, measuring cups, colander, cheese grater, can opener, meat thermometer, wine openers, wine glasses, dishes and silverware, dish towels. Salt and pepper, coffee filters, and coffee in the fridge.
LAUNDRY In-unit washer and dryer in the butler's pantry, plus a clothes drying rack and steamer.
ENTERTAINMENT Three TVs (living room, primary bedroom, sunroom), each with a Roku streaming device. Netflix is signed in and ready — guests can also log into their own services. The primary bedroom TV supports Chromecast.
INTERNET High-speed 2-gig fiber with a battery backup that keeps the WiFi alive through brief outages. Built for remote work, video calls, and streaming.
EARLY ARRIVAL Check-in is 3 PM, but if you get into town early just message me. I live on the same street and I'm usually happy to hold your bags at my place while the cleaners finish up.
ON-SITE RENTAL TRUCK (optional) There's a pickup in the driveway that rents through Turo. If it's parked there, it's available — book it on the app, or message me and I'll set it up. The house, the yard, and the hot tub are yours alone. It sits off to the side and won't affect your parking, and anyone coming to pick it up is in and out of the driveway only.

About the host
Hosted by Joseph lundgren
Hi, I'm Joe — your host. I'm a McKinney local with a soft spot for old houses, vintage objects, and the particular kind of comfort that comes from a place that's been thoughtfully lived in. When I'm not hosting, I run Vintage McKinney, an antique shop in town that supplies many of the curated details you'll find at the property.
My goal is to give guests a calm, characterful base — whether you're here for work, an extended stay, or a long weekend exploring downtown McKinney's restaurants and antique stores. I keep communication friendly and brief: you'll have everything you need before you arrive, and I'm a quick message away if anything comes up during your stay.
If you spot something at the house you love, there's a good chance you can pick up something similar at the shop on the historic square.
Why they chose this property
This neighborhood is the sweet spot between quiet and convenient. Tree-lined streets, mature landscaping, and neighbors who wave when you pull in — but you're a 3-minute drive to Highway 380 and 8 minutes to Historic Downtown McKinney's town square. That square is a treasure: brick streets, restaurants, antique shops, a performing arts center, and the kind of weekend pace that feels like a different decade.
For travel pros and remote workers, the location puts you minutes from the McKinney medical corridor, US-75, and a quick straight shot down to Allen, Plano, and the DFW airports. It's a low-stress base for working in the area without sacrificing a peaceful place to come home to.
What makes this property unique
Two things set this house apart.
First, the vintage character — every room has been thoughtfully curated with restored antiques, period light fixtures, and small details that make the home feel collected rather than decorated. It's the kind of place you notice something new every day of your stay.
Second, and the reason a lot of guests book: a 40-plus-foot concrete pad runs the length of the fenced backyard, accessible through a double gate off the driveway. You can pull a truck, trailer, RV, or work equipment straight in and lock it up overnight. Contractors and traveling professionals consistently tell us it's the deciding factor — secure parking is rare in this kind of residential setting.
Add 2-gig fiber WiFi with battery backup, a sunroom-converted fourth bedroom with its own back-door entrance, and three TVs with streaming, and the house works equally well for solo workers, multi-room families, and traveling teams.
